Syn flood program in python using raw sockets linux dns query code in c with linux sockets this site, is a participant in the amazon services llc associates program, an affiliate advertising program designed to provide a means for sites to earn advertising fees by advertising and linking to. As we can see, hping3 is a multipurpose network packet tool with a wide variety of uses, and its extremely useful for testing and supporting systems. Hi, this is a syn attack, in the same way, that every car is. The syn flood that i was experiencing at the time came to a halt instantly. Feb 23, 2017 mastering kali linux for advanced penetration testing. Syn flood a form of ddos attack in which bots attempt to open. The system using windows is also based on tcpip, therefore it is not. Antiflood script by rath on dec 21, 2007 this script will ban then kick a user if he typed 6 lines in 4 seconds, of course you can edit this if you like. A syn flood attack circumvents this smooth exchange by not sending the ack to the server after its initial synack has been sent. This project is intended to add an administration interface for hidden flood control variables in drupal 7, like the login attempt limiters and any future hidden variables. To understand syn flooding, lets have a look at three way tcp handshake.
Syn flood a form of ddos attack in which bots attempt to. How to use linux iptables to block different attacks. A novel approach for mitigating the effects of the tcp syn. A syn flood halfopen attack is a type of denialofservice ddos attack which aims to make a server unavailable to legitimate traffic by consuming all. The simulation scenario consists of attacker, bots controlled by the attacker and. A syn flood halfopen attack is a type of denialofservice ddos attack which aims to make a server unavailable to legitimate traffic by consuming all available server resources. Figure 6 shows a snippet of the downloader preparing a url. Syn flood is a type of dos denial of service attack.
Instructor the most common technique used in denial of service attacks is the tcp syn flood. Tcp syn flooding attack is a kind of denialofservice attack. One campaign peaked at 119 gbps bandwidth and 110 mpps in volume. And despite me using the internet for another 34 hours last night, i never had another instance all night long. When the syn packet arrives, a buffer is allocated to provide state information for the. A novel approach for mitigating the effects of the tcp syn flood. Eucalyptus cloud, denial of service attack, tcp syn flood, artificial neural network, knearest neighbor. Hello i have a question, in what line it set the tcp header to the send packet. A syn flood ddos attack exploits a known weakness in the tcp connection sequence the threeway handshake, wherein a syn request to initiate a tcp connection with a host must be answered by a synack response from that host, and then confirmed by an ack response from the requester. The malicious client can either simply not send the expected ack, or by spoofing the source ip address in the syn, causing the server to send the synack to a falsified ip address which will not send an ack because it knows that it never sent a syn. Free ddos script 2017 ntp reflection attack youtube.
Introduction cloud computing is an emerging technological advancement in providing information technology. As a result of the attacker using a single source device with a real ip address to create the attack, the attacker is highly vulnerable to discovery and mitigation. Dns floods are used for attacking both the infrastructure and a dns application to overwhelm a target system and consume all its available network bandwidth. Syn flood dos attack from my macbook pro macrumors forums. Use flood script and thousands of other assets to build an immersive game or experience.
Today, we will see how to use metasploit to scan port. Guide to ddos attacks center for internet security. The tcp handshake takes a threephase connection of syn, synack, and ack packets. By repeatedly sending initial connection request syn packets, the attacker is able to overwhelm all available ports on a targeted server machine, causing the. Syn flood udp flood amplified ssdp, chargen, dns, snmp, ntp, etc ip fragmentation.
It is up to organizations to secure their networks and servers against such attacks. Denial of service attack called tcpsyn flood ddos attack which is. Tcp syn flood denial of service seung jae won university of windsor. A denial of service attack can be carried out using syn flooding, ping of death, teardrop, smurf or buffer overflow.
Port scan is often done by hackers and penetration testers to identifying and discovering internal services of target host. May 18, 2011 syn flood attack is a form of denialofservice attack in which an attacker sends a large number of syn requests to a target systems services that use tcp protocol. Select from a wide range of models, decals, meshes, plugins, or audio that help bring your imagination into reality. Finally, practical approaches against syn flood attack for linux and windows. Perl flood script ddos reck may th, 2012 23,379 never. Mastering kali linux for advanced penetration testing. We use cookies for various purposes including analytics. If the number of syn attack from a ip exceeds 50 request per second, that ip will be blocked. Download fulltext pdf download fulltext pdf download fulltext pdf download fulltext pdf. You can also see syn flood traffic under ss, although by default ss hides this traffic category. Anti flood script by rath on dec 21, 2007 this script will ban then kick a user if he typed 6 lines in 4 seconds, of course you can edit this if you like. This paper present how the tcp syn flood takes place and show the number of packets received by the victim server under the attack. Port scanning is an important action for gathering more information of the target host. As we all knows metasploit framework is a free and open.
How to ddos mac os ping flood, or perl script slowloris on mac osx duration. If the average syn rate in 10 seconds exceeds maximum halfopen sockets, it will perform syn cookie on all subsequent new connections syn packets of this. Pdf this paper concerns the tcp transmission control protocol. Download fulltext pdf download fulltext pdf download fulltext pdf download fulltext pdf download. These tools can be downloaded, installed, and utilized. It will take a lot of effort on the system administrators part. These days most computer system is operated on tcpip. The proposed framework detects denial of service attack such as tcp syn flood based on threshold and misuse detection.
I setup a target vm, disabled iptables and running hping hping p 80 i u c s destaddr from couple of local source machines filtering rst in output chain of those. Pyflood dos flooder syntcp udp loldongs sep 28th, 20 5,367 never not a member of pastebin yet. Select from a wide range of models, decals, meshes, plugins, or. If the warning or critical thresholds are reached the script will exit with the correct status code and return an output with who the top offenders are although the source ip is.
Several tcp or udpbased port scans, but no syn floods and no slowdowns in internet speed. Im trying to simulate a tcp syn flood to tune a web server planning to deploy on aws. Contribute to arthurnnsynflood development by creating an account on github. Security patches for operating systems, router configuration, firewalls and intrusion detection systems can be used to protect against denial of service attacks. By now it is clear that syn flood attacks can do massive damage to an organization in terms of monetary loss and loss of reputation. The goal of a syn flood is to use all the victims bandwidth or, more likely to consume so much of the victims computing resources memory, cpu, storage space, etc. In this attack, the attacker does not mask their ip address at all. A study and detection of tcp syn flood attacks with ip. Disables the check comment flood feature so comments can be postdated. Syn flood a form of ddos attack in which bots attempt to open new tcp connections with the victims server. How to perform ping of death attack using cmd and notepad. However its a build in mechanism that you send a reset back for the other side to close the socket. Syn flood dos attack with c source code linux binarytides.
Denial of service dos and distributed denial of service ddos attacks are an ever present threat to online businesses that can lead to downed websites, lost traffic and damaged client relationships. Detecting tcp syn flood attack in the cloud raneel kumar1, sunil lal2, alok sharma1,3 1 university of the south pacific, fiji. Pdf analysis of the syn flood dos attack researchgate. The remote executable to download and run is then called by an additional userdefined function named shelleexec. Syn flood dos attack from my macbook pro macrumors. The clever part of this attack is that tcp on the victims system will. Possible syn flooding messages in system logs marklogic. Download syn flood source codes, syn flood scripts flood.
Hi, this is a syn attack, in the same way, that every car is a race car. You can change the script to make a ackrstfinetc script. Learn how to perform the ping of death attack using command prompt on windows 10 for denial of service attacks. Python syn flood attack tool, you can start syn flood attack with this tool.
The tcp syn flood happens when this threepacket handshake doesnt complete properly. Ill open a terminal window and take a look at hping3. After the syn cookie option is enabled, each virtual server will monitor syn rate. This syn flooding attack is using the weakness of tcpip. Syn flood with game i am playing an online game called asherons call, a game that was created in 1996, and was bought out by turbine about 121 yeah ago. Apr 02, 2016 how to ddos mac os ping flood, or perl script slowloris on mac osx duration. A simple tutorial on how to perform dos attack using ping of death using cmd. If the average syn rate in 10 seconds exceeds maximum half. Linksys is saying either port forward, port trigger, or use dmz host, but only one at a time. Either that packet is completely omitted or the response might contain misleading information such as a spoofed ip address, thus forcing the server to try and then connect to another machine entirely.
Pdf tcp syn flooding attack in wireless networks researchgate. Dec 04, 2019 asyncrone a syn flood ddos tool december 4, 2019 comments off on asyncrone a syn flood ddos tool cybersecurity ethical hacking hack android hack app hack wordpress hacker news hacking hacking tools for windows keylogger kit kitploit password brute force penetration testing pentest pentest android pentest linux pentest toolkit pentest. This is fantastic, works like a dream, and stops flood very quick. What is a dosddos attack script or toolkit ddos tools. Before any information is exchanged between a client and the server using tcp protocol, a connection is formed by the tcp handshake. A syn flood attack works by not responding to the server with the expected ack code. The attacker sends tcp connection requests faster than the targeted machine can process them, causing network saturation. Perl flood script ddos reck may th, 2012 23,379 never not a member of pastebin yet. This consumes the server resources to make the system unresponsive to even legitimate traffic. Defending against syn flood is difficult, but not impossible. A syn flood is one of the most common forms of ddos attacks observed by the ms isac. A syn flood where the ip address is not spoofed is known as a direct attack. Complete support most popular attacks for channel overflow.
1334 790 1345 1462 1159 56 246 578 399 1168 1451 1214 1207 1159 58 395 353 15 1410 975 993 615 778 33 792 850 1395 1133 45 692 841 654 282 1069 1436 746 1250 608 1149 1484 509 596 1102 795 400 886 41 462